The Importance of High-Quality Art Files in DTF Printing
In the world of DTF printing, the quality of your art files can make or break your designs. High-quality art files, ideally in vector formats like .AI or .EPS, ensure that your graphics maintain clarity and sharpness even when scaled. This is particularly crucial for custom apparel printing where intricate designs must be reproduced with precision. To avoid pixelation that can ruin the aesthetic of a printed garment, it is essential to start your design workflow with high-resolution images, with a minimum of 300 DPI, thus ensuring every detail is captured accurately.

What are the best practices for using a DTF gangsheet builder in custom apparel printing?
To optimize the use of a DTF gangsheet builder in custom apparel printing, start by utilizing high-quality art files in vector formats like .AI or .EPS, ensuring a minimum resolution of 300 DPI. Focus on maximizing colors by using the CMYK color space to prevent unexpected shifts. Efficient gangsheet layouts should place designs closely without overlapping, and always incorporate a bleed area to avoid misalignment during the transfer process.

What are the key factors to consider when performing test prints with a DTF gangsheet builder?
When performing test prints with a DTF gangsheet builder, consider factors such as color accuracy, alignment, and design size. Test prints help to identify potential issues early, allowing for adjustments before the final production run.
